uPVC will change colour with time, either because of exposure to the sun or natural ageing. This can be a big issue, especially if it isn't in harmony with your home. This is a common problem which can be fixed easily. The first step is to sand the doors' surface using a medium-grit, sandpaper. Then, it's followed by a fine-grit sandpaper. This will remove any blemishes from the surface and make it smooth.

After sanding your uPVC doors, it is recommended to apply a primer. This will allow the paint to stick to the surface. After 24 hours, apply the paint. Once the paint has dried, you can seal it with a clear varnish to protect it from weathering.

Before you start the process of repairing your door handle, it is essential to wash the area thoroughly. This will ensure that there is a smooth, even surface to repair. Fill any dents or cracks using wood putty, bondo or similar products to make the area appear as smooth and natural.

Check the screws that are holding your handle in place. They're usually on the inside of the door and could be covered with caps to improve aesthetics. Once you've located the screws, remove them with the screwdriver. After that, you'll be able to remove the handle and the spindle out of the door. Install the handle after adding new washers as well as a nylon ring and new washers to the handle plate.
